Figure pour l'abrégé : Figure 18System (34) for controlling the angular pitch of a propeller blade (10), for an aircraft turbine engine, characterized in that it comprises: - a blade (10) comprising a blade (12) connected to a root (14), - a bowl (58) comprising an annular wall (58a) extending around an axis (A) for wedging the blade (10) and a lower axial end closed by a bottom wall ( 58b), - an immobilization ring (52) which extends around the foot (14) and inside the bowl (58), and a safety element (110, 110') which ensures the retention of the foot (14) vis-à-vis the bowl (58), said at least one safety element (110, 110') having a generally elongated shape and passing through orifices (112, 114, 126) aligned in the bottom wall ( 58b) of the bowl (58) as well as the free end (28) of the foot (14).
